Fuse Taps - Always Hot / ACC Hot

Hello.

Has anyone figured out which fuses are always hot or hot when key is turned to acc (on)? I'd like to hardwire a few different accessories (bluetooth handsfree, gps, ipod). It seems easiest to tap from the fuse box and the bluetooth handsfree needs both positive connections (always hot and acc).

I used:

Fuse 25 - Door Lock - For my constant power
Fuse 35 - Acc, Radio - on with key turned

PLEASE DO NOT USE YOUR FUSES FOR YOUR POWER CONNECTIONS!!!!

Get the right tools and make your electrical connections correctly with wire strippers, solder, and electrical tape!

If you need to know wire colors just ask! And then you don't have to worry about wiring anything to the fuse box which is an unprofessional, unsafe, untrustworthy way of wiring ANYTHING up.

If the dealership sees that you have done this, they will laugh and blame whatever problems you have on that, if the connections are made properly they won't say a word. Radio 12v white + radio harness
Radio Ground black - radio harness
Radio Ignition purple + radio harness
Radio Illumination gray or red/black + radio harness
Factory Amp Turn-on lt. blue + radio harness
Power Antenna gray + radio harness
